ENGINE DETAIL
The Kubota L3901 tractor features a robust 3-cylinder diesel engine with a displacement of 1.8L, delivering a gross power output of 37.5hp at 2700 RPM, making it suitable for various agricultural tasks. Its common rail direct injection fuel system enhances fuel efficiency and ensures reduced emissions, compliant with Tier IV regulations. While this tractor offers reliable performance for small to medium-sized farms, potential users should be aware of the power limitations for larger implements or extensive workloads.

TRANSMISSIONS OVERVIEW
The Kubota L3901 features an 8-speed synchronized shuttle hydrostatic transmission, providing seamless gear transitions and enhanced control during varying operational tasks. This setup is advantageous for maneuvering in tight spaces and improving productivity in both fieldwork and loader applications. However, while hydrostatic systems offer ease of use, they may require more maintenance than traditional gear transmissions.

TRANSMISSION 2
The Kubota L3901 features a hydrostatic transmission, providing seamless speed control, which enhances maneuverability for various tasks, particularly in tight spaces. Its infinite gear selection across 3 ranges allows for optimized torque application and fuel efficiency, making it suitable for diverse agricultural operations. However, while hydrostatic systems typically require less maintenance, they can be less efficient than traditional gear-driven systems in heavy-duty applications.

KUBOTA L3901 TIRES
The Kubota L3901 offers versatile tire options catering to different applications: 2WD and 4WD configurations, with standard agricultural tires providing optimal traction for agricultural use, while turf and industrial tires enhance performance in specific scenarios. The 4WD variant, fitted with larger front tires (7.2-16) and the ability to adapt to turf or industrial tires, is better suited for varied terrains and more robust applications. This adaptability is advantageous for farmers needing maneuverability on soft or uneven land, but the 2WD model may struggle in challenging conditions compared to its 4WD counterpart.
